WebSep 10, 2024 · The ocean has an equatorial bulge. The Earth is also fluid on a geologic time scale. The center is molten and can flow. But even solid rock flows over millions of years. The Earth slowly flows and maintains an equatorial bulge too. This explanation was from an inertial frame of reference. No pseudo forces were needed. WebFigure 13.22 The tidal force stretches Earth along the line between Earth and the Moon. It is the difference between the gravitational force from the far side to the near side that creates the tidal bulge on both sides of the planet. Tidal variations of the oceans are on the order of few meters; hence, this diagram is greatly exaggerated. WebApr 12, 2007 · He was correct and, because of this bulge, the distance from Earth's center to sea level is roughly 21 kilometers (13 miles) greater at the equator than at the poles.

One other parameter affecting LOS propagation is the earth’s curvature. The rule of thumb is a transmitter at sea level has a LOS of seven miles if unobstructed, which is referred to as an “earth bulge.” Another factor is the effect of atmosphere on propagation.
